TERMS AND CONDITIONS OF THE SALE:

At the time of the sale, the successful bidder shall be required to deposit with the Internal Revenue Service (IRS), Property Appraisal and Liquidation Specialist (PALS), a minimum of $25,836 (20% of minimum bid) by cash or certified or cashier’s check payable to the United States District Court for the District of Minnesota, immediately upon the Property being struck off and awarded to the highest bidder. Before being permitted to bid at the sale, bidders shall display to the IRS proof that they are able to comply with this requirement. No bids will be received from any person(s) who have not presented proof that, if they are the successful bidder(s), they can make the payment required by this Order of Sale.

The balance of the sale price must be tendered to IRS by certified funds, payable to the United States District Court for the District of Minnesota, no later than thirty (30) days after the sale is confirmed by the court. If the bidder fails to fulfill this requirement, the deposit shall be forfeited and the Property shall again be offered for sale or sold to the second highest bidder without further permission of the Court under the terms and conditions of the Order of Sale.

The sale shall be free and clear of the interests of Ray J. and Shirley Ann Petersen and all parties named in the suit. The sale shall be subject to building lines, if established, all laws, ordinances, and governmental regulation (including building and zoning ordinances), affecting the Property, and easements and restrictions of record, if any.

The sale is ordered pursuant to 28 U.S.C Sec. 2001 and 2002, and is made without right of redemption.

The Property is offered “as is” and “where is” and without recourse against the United States. The United States makes no guaranty or warranty of condition of the Property, or its fitness for any purpose. The United States will not consider any claim for allowance or adjustment or for the rescission of the sale based on failure of the Property to comply with any expressed or implied representation.

The sale of the Property is subject to confirmation by the Court. On confirmation of the sale and receipt of the entire purchase price, the IRS shall execute a deed of real estate conveying the Property to the purchaser. The Dakota County Recorder shall cause transfer of the Property to be reflected upon that county’s register of title. The successful bidder at the sale shall pay, in addition to the amount of the bid, any documentary stamps and Clerk’s registry fees as provided by law. On confirmation of the sale, all interests in, liens against, or claims to the Property that are held or asserted by all parties in Civil No. 0:07-cv-04790-JMR-JJK, are discharged and extinguished.



IMPORTANT INFORMATION

This is not an advertisement of a sale of seized property. This is an information notice only regarding a sale being conducted by the IRS as a result of the foreclosure of an IRS Federal Tax lien by the U.S. Department of Justice.
